Abstract: Let A be a K-subalgebra of the polynomial ring S=K[x1,ldots,xd] of dimension d, generated by finitely many monomials of degree r. Then the Gauss algebra GG(A) of A is generated by monomials of degree (r1)d in S. We describe the generators and the structure of GG(A), when A is a Borel fixed algebra, a squarefree Veronese algebra, generated in degree 2, or the edge ring of a bipartite graph with at least one loop. For a bipartite graph G with one loop, the embedding dimension of GG(A) is bounded by the complexity of the graph G.
